Overview
- The Los Angeles Police Department said Christina Downer has not been found and the case has not been reclassified as a homicide.
- The statement counters a public post from her brother, SNL writer Jimmy Fowlie, who said police told the family she is no longer alive.
- Robbery-Homicide Division detectives are leading the inquiry and describe the circumstances of her disappearance as suspicious.
- Fowlie has alleged that Christina’s phone and social media were taken over before she vanished to push a false story and to request money.
- Downer was last seen in Los Angeles’ Koreatown in late November and police are asking anyone with information to contact the Missing Persons Unit or department tip lines.
